Audit team reports frequently adhere to the rule of the Five Cs of data sharing and communication, and a thorough summary in a report will include each of these elements. The Five Cs are criteria, condition, cause, consequence, and corrective action.

Types of Internal audits include compliance audits, operational audits, financial audits, and an information technology audits.
A 5S audit is a systematic review of a workplace to ensure adherence to the 5S principles: Sort, Set in Order, Shine, Standardize, and Sustain. It helps identify areas for improvement and maintain a clean, organized, and efficient workspace.
